Academics
WSU Tri-Cities offers over 20 bachelor's and 30 graduate degree programs across six academic colleges, including Arts & Sciences, Business, Education, Engineering & Applied Sciences, Nursing, and Agricultural, Human, and Natural Resource Sciences. The university is known for its polytechnic approach, emphasizing hands-on, project-based learning. Notable programs include viticulture and enology, with the technologically advanced Ste. Michelle Wine Estates WSU Wine Science Center, and strong STEM offerings, with all engineering and computer science programs accredited by ABET.

Campus & Location
Located along the Columbia River in Richland, Washington, WSU Tri-Cities offers a beautiful and peaceful campus setting. The campus is part of the Tri-Cities Research District, providing proximity to the Pacific Northwest National Laboratory and other high-profile companies. While the social scene may be quieter than larger university campuses, there are many opportunities for student engagement through clubs and activities. The Tri-Cities area itself offers a variety of restaurants, wineries, breweries, parks, and cultural attractions.
Career Outcomes
WSU Tri-Cities boasts strong career outcomes for its graduates, with 92% of May 2015 graduates reporting a "positive outcome" within six months of graduation, significantly higher than the national average. This includes 80% employed full-time and 5% pursuing further education. The university has strong industry connections and a focus on career readiness, offering internships and real-world experiences with regional companies like Pacific Northwest National Laboratory, Bechtel National, Inc., and Lockheed Martin. Career services include career coaching, job and internship search assistance, and professional development through programs like "Cougar Tracks." The university also fosters an entrepreneurial spirit through its Entrepreneurs in Residence program, connecting students with successful entrepreneurs for mentorship.
